WebApr 21, 2024 · A confidence interval for a population standard deviation is a range of values that is likely to contain a population standard deviation with a certain level of confidence. The formula to calculate this confidence interval is: Confidence interval = [√ (n-1)s 2 /X 2α/2, √ (n-1)s 2 /X 21-α/2] where: n: sample size. s 2: sample variance. I used the following code: X6 <- data.frame (V2=6) predict … higher rate tax pension calculatorWebTo get a 90% confidence interval, we must include the central 90% of the probability of the normal distribution. If we include the central 90%, we leave out a total of α = 10% in both tails, or 5% in each tail, of the normal distribution.
